Docsity
Docsity

Prepara tus exámenes
Prepara tus exámenes

Prepara tus exámenes y mejora tus resultados gracias a la gran cantidad de recursos disponibles en Docsity


Consigue puntos base para descargar
Consigue puntos base para descargar

Gana puntos ayudando a otros estudiantes o consíguelos activando un Plan Premium


Orientación Universidad
Orientación Universidad


informe curso integrador, Ejercicios de Seguridad Informática

primer avance curso integrador pagina web

Tipo: Ejercicios

2022/2023

Subido el 26/05/2023

carlos-llallacachi-ventura-1
carlos-llallacachi-ventura-1 🇵🇪

3 documentos

1 / 49

Toggle sidebar

Esta página no es visible en la vista previa

¡No te pierdas las partes importantes!

bg1
FACULTAD DE INGENIERÍA
Carrera Profesional de Ingeniería de
Sistemas e Informática
Curso Integrador I:
Sistemas y Software
Título:
Diseño e Implementación de un sistema web para la gestión
del SPA UTP
Ciclo: VI
Autores:
Choquehuanca Chuctaya, Carlos Alfredo U19220586
Llallacachi Ventura, Carlos Eiral U20236556
Villanueva Huaylla, Angye Michell 1630295
Docente: Ing. Aníbal Sardón Paniagua
Arequipa - Perú
2023
pf3
pf4
pf5
pf8
pf9
pfa
pfd
pfe
pff
pf12
pf13
pf14
pf15
pf16
pf17
pf18
pf19
pf1a
pf1b
pf1c
pf1d
pf1e
pf1f
pf20
pf21
pf22
pf23
pf24
pf25
pf26
pf27
pf28
pf29
pf2a
pf2b
pf2c
pf2d
pf2e
pf2f
pf30
pf31

Vista previa parcial del texto

¡Descarga informe curso integrador y más Ejercicios en PDF de Seguridad Informática solo en Docsity!

FACULTAD DE INGENIERÍA

Carrera Profesional de Ingeniería de

Sistemas e Informática

Curso Integrador I:

Sistemas y Software

Título:

Diseño e Implementación de un sistema web para la gestión

del SPA UTP

Ciclo: VI

Autores:

Choquehuanca Chuctaya, Carlos Alfredo U

Llallacachi Ventura, Carlos Eiral U

Villanueva Huaylla, Angye Michell 1630295

Docente: Ing. Aníbal Sardón Paniagua

Arequipa - Perú

ÍNDICE

Contenido

RESUMEN ABSTRACT CAPÍTULO 1 - ASPECTOS GENERALES 1.1 DEFINICIÓN DEL PROBLEMA 1.1.1 DESCRIPCIÓN DEL PROBLEMA 1.1.2 DIAGRAMAS DE PROCESOS DE NEGOCIO 1.2 PLANTEAMIENTO DE ALTERNATIVAS DE SOLUCIÓN 1.3 DEFINICIÓN DE OBJETIVOS 1.3.1 OBJETIVO GENERAL 1.3.2 OBJETIVOS ESPECÍFICOS 1.3.3 ALCANCES Y LIMITACIONES 1.3.4 JUSTIFICACIÓN 1.3.5 ESTADO DEL ARTE CAPÍTULO 2 - MARCO TEÓRICO 2.1 FUNDAMENTO TEÓRICO CAPÍTULO 3 - DESARROLLO DE LA SOLUCIÓN 3.1 ANÁLISIS DEL SISTEMA 3.1.1 REQUISITOS FUNCIONALES 3.1.2 REQUISITOS NO FUNCIONALES 3.2. DISEÑO DEL SISTEMA 3.2.1 CASOS DE USO 3.2.2 DISEÑO DE CLASES 3.2.3 DISEÑO DE LA BASE DE DATOS 3.2.4 CÓDIGO FUENTE CONCLUSIONES RECOMENDACIONES BIBLIOGRAFÍA ANEXOS ANEXO 1 PROJECT CHARTER ANEXO 2 MODELO LEAN CANVAS ANEXO 3 ENCUESTAS

ÍNDICE DE TABLAS

Tabla 1

HISTORIAL DE VERSIONES Fecha de Elaboración Versión Elaborado por Descripción Revisado por Fecha de Revisión 20/04/2023 1.0 Equipo Documentación y propuesta de solución web

CAPÍTULO 1

ASPECTOS GENERALES

1.1. DEFINICIÓN DEL PROBLEMA

1.1.1. DESCRIPCIÓN DEL PROBLEMA

Descripción de la empresa El SPA UTP nace a partir de la necesidad de quienes buscan recuperarse del estrés de la vida cotidiana, encontrando un equilibrio de mente, cuerpo y espíritu en las diversas actividades que ofrece el spa en sus distintas sedes de Arequipa. Por otro lado, la empresa cuenta con técnicos especializados y preparados para ofrecer un servicio de calidad y profesionalismo en diversos tipos de tratamientos naturales. Visión Ser de los mejores centros de salud natural y terapia de la región Arequipa, con servicios e instalaciones modernas y lograr fidelizar a nuestros clientes a través de la mejora y calidad que tengan nuestros servicios. Misión Garantizar una experiencia inolvidable y de calidad con terapias que unen los cuatro elementos: tierra, agua, fuego y aire; de este modo poder dar un equilibrio de mente, cuerpo y espíritu. Descripción de funciones de empleados Encargado: Está a cargo de registrar en hojas de cálculo la información actualizada de los técnicos cada vez que ingresan nuevos o se retiran, además de la información actualizada de los servicios y los insumos que se retira del almacén para realizar los tratamientos. Administrador: Está a cargo de registrar en hojas de cálculo la información de los pagos y organizar los horarios de los técnicos y sedes disponibles. Técnico: Está a cargo de registrar en hojas de cálculo la información de “Orden de atención” los datos del cliente, fecha y servicios ofrecidos. Problemática y justificación Dado el crecimiento masivo de las redes sociales y que la mayoría de personas cuenta con dispositivos móviles, impulsa a que la mayoría de empresas busquen publicitarse y tener su espacio en internet, el SPA UTP actualmente se ve limitada dada la falta de organización e incomunicación entre los encargados, administradores y técnicos, la gran demanda de clientes que buscan poder reservar citas de manera virtual y un ineficiente control de solicitudes de servicio que conlleva a un tiempo de respuesta, reportes y soluciones muy deficientes. En este sentido, es indudable que las tecnologías de la información son elementos indispensables para la competitividad y comodidad del usuario final, ya que es importante que las empresas integren este tipo de tecnologías que brindan ventajas comparativas con respecto a la competencia, por lo cual aplicarla mediantes una solución tecnológica para automatizar procesos es clave del avance y crecimiento que tendrá el SPA UTP.

1.1.2. DIAGRAMAS DE PROCESOS DE NEGOCIO

BPMN de Proceso de Registro de Clientes BPMN de Proceso de Programación de los Técnicos BPMN de Proceso de Atención en el SPA

SERVICIOS En los servicios se visualizará la lista de precios, duración y una breve descripción. ESPECIALISTA En especialista se visualizará la lista de especialistas que se tiene

PERFIL En perfil nos mostrará una lista de opciones donde podrán los clientes modificar su perfil, también podrán ver el historial de servicios realizados,ademas podran elegir la opcion para ingresar su metodo de pago SOLUCIÓN ALTERNATIVA DE SOLUCIÓN 2 Como segunda alternativa de solución, se plantea la implementación de pantallas con programas desarrollados en java, para ordenar citas y servicios en los ingresos a los locales, los cuales podrán realizarlo de manera instantánea en las mismas sedes, lo cual mejorará el flujo de atención en la misma sede. Pantalla Principal

SOLUCIÓN ALTERNATIVA DE SOLUCIÓN 3

Como tercera alternativa de solución, se plantea implementar un sistema web desarrollado con java y puesto en un servidor con base de datos para registros, procesos y reportes. Por otro lado, buscará agilizar las citas, reservaciones y a su vez poder llevar un registro de los clientes que son más habituales, para poder enviarles ofertas y descuentos en productos y poder fidelizarlos a la empresa. PÁGINA PRINCIPAL

En la página principal, presentará un menú para ingresar a la página de reservas, Servicios, precios, así como una breve información sobre el proyecto, motivación, quienes somos entre otros. RESERVAS En la página de reserva, podremos acceder a un formulario en el cual se podrá elegir los servicios a tomar, así como los horarios disponibles de cada técnico encargado.

ADMINISTRACIÓN Alternativa de solución elegida Dado que en la actualidad las personas buscan la facilidad de poder acceder a cierto servicio desde múltiples equipos o plataformas se decidió optar por la alternativa de solución 3 que propone un sistema web, ya que no requerirá de hardware específico para cumplir su función dado que es adaptable y estará disponible 24/7. 1.3. DEFINICIÓN DE OBJETIVOS 1.3.1. OBJETIVO GENERAL Diseñar e implementar un sistema autogestionable y automatizado para la administración de citas, usuarios, servicios, técnicos, encargados y la creación de reportes de pagos en la empresa SPA UTP. 1.3.2. OBJETIVOS ESPECÍFICOS ● Analizar los procesos de negocio y la problemática dentro la empresa. ● Presentar alternativas de solución que se adecuen a la necesidad.

● Crear un sistema web para la gestión de los recursos, técnicos, usuarios y encargados. ● Crear un entorno amigable y de fácil manejo para los clientes y usuarios. ● Brindar reportes exactos sobre la ganancia por cada servicio. ● Capacitar al personal de la empresa para el manejo adecuado del sistema. 1.3.3. ALCANCES Y LIMITACIONES 1.3.3.1. Dentro del Alcance El presente proyecto comprende las etapas de análisis, diseño, desarrollo e implementación de un sistema web en la empresa SPA UTP, no requerirá de hardware específico. Por otro lado, se desarrollará en una plataforma de software libre cuyos principales procesos a ejecutar son: ● Registro de usuarios y citas. ● Logueo de usuarios ● Asignación técnico-horario. ● Mantenimiento de los técnicos. ● Mantenimiento de los clientes. ● Mantenimiento de los servicios. ● Mantenimiento de los encargados. ● Registro de pago por cita. ● Mantenimiento técnico-horario. ● Reporte de ganancias por servicio y general. 1.3.3.2. Fuera del Alcance El proyecto solo trabaja con procesos relacionados a citas, solo acepta pagos por aplicativos de banca online (Yape, Plin, Tunki, etc), a continuación algunos procesos fuera de alcance son: ● Atención a personas de otras regiones. ● Ingreso de pagos por tarjeta de crédito. ● Planillas de trabajadores. ● Correos o mensajes dentro del sistema web. ● Ventas de productos. 1.3.3.3. Limitaciones ❖ El sistema web no podrá implementar ventas ni seguimientos de pedidos. ❖ La tecnología aplicada en el sistema web requerirá de un mínimo de condiciones para poder cargar correctamente los módulos y la página web. ❖ La condición del servicio web ofrecido dependerá de la disponibilidad de los servidores y la conectividad que nos ofrezca el proveedor de internet. ❖ El sistema solo se ofrecerá en español y partes en inglés.

CAPÍTULO 2

MARCO TEÓRICO

1.1. FUNDAMENTO TEÓRICO

CAPÍTULO 3

DISEÑO DE LA SOLUCIÓN

2.1. ANÁLISIS DEL SISTEMA

2.1.1. REQUISITOS FUNCIONALEs RF001 Registro de cliente Descripción El sistema permite el ingreso de datos básicos de los clientes tales como Nombre, Apellidos, correo electrónico, dirección y teléfono para poder registrarse. Importancia Alta RF002 Registro de técnicos Descripción El sistema permite el ingreso de datos de los técnicos tales como Nombre, Apellidos, correo electrónico, área, dirección y teléfono para poder registrarse. Importancia Alta RF003 Registro de reserva Descripción El sistema permite el ingreso de datos de los clientes, fecha y hora de la reserva, descripción del servicio que tomará el cliente. Importancia Alta RF004 Registro de servicio Descripción El sistema permite visualizar la hoja de servicio llenado por el técnico de acuerdo a lo solicitado por el cliente y verificado por el encargado. Importancia Alta